Minutes — Management Meeting (Sales Leads)

Topic: Q3 Budget Request

Denna presented the ask: extra headcount for the Larkspur accounts and a bump to the travel line. Finance pushed back a bit on the events spend, so we trimmed it. Revised figures go to Orvan by Friday. Sales leads should hold commitments until sign-off. The thinking behind the reallocation is set out below.

internal memo for haduf-fajeg: Headcount on the Quenwyn team goes from 7 to 80 by the end of July. Gross margin on Quenwyn came in at 10 percent against a plan of 15 percent.

To: Executive Team
From: Lenna Voss
Subject: FY headcount plan

Next year's plan: net +38 roles. Engineering +22, mostly on the Arclight programme; field sales +10 in the Tarnow region; operations +6. Backfills frozen in marketing until Q2. Attrition assumption holds at 9%. Budget impact is within the envelope agreed in October. Incoming director Soren Blaik owns final allocations from January. The confidential planning context he should read first appears directly below.

board note of bahaf-kahif: Gross margin on Wenael came in at 10 percent against a plan of 15 percent. Only 7 of the 120 pilot accounts renewed Wenael, so a churn review is set for July 1.

Subject: Franchise Agreement — Tillbrook Eateries

Board members,

We have reached agreed terms with the Nareth Hill group: ten-year term, exclusive territory, royalties at the standard rate with a performance clause. Legal review is complete and signing is scheduled for month-end. Please review the attached summary before Thursday's vote. The confidential note below sets out the related plans.

confidential, kagep-kahof: Druokax Systems plans to lower the Ulaath list price by 53 percent in March.